General Information

Established in 2024 and launching its first class in October 2025, the Gutwirth Medical School represents a historic shift for the Weizmann Institute traditionally a pure research institution into the realm of medical education. This elite, highly specialized school was founded to bridge the widening gap between basic scientific discovery and clinical application. It offers a unique 7.5-year MD-PhD program (the first of its kind in Israel to be fully integrated from day one) designed to train physician-scientists. By combining Weizmann’s world-class research infrastructure with clinical training at Israel's top hospitals, the school aims to produce leaders who can solve urgent medical challenges using the tools of exact sciences, data science, and AI.


General Info

  • Established: 2024 (Inaugural class: October 2025).
  • Primary Location: > Weizmann Institute Campus, Herzl St 234, Rehovot, Israel.
  • Academic Model: Integrated MD-PhD.
  • Structure: A 7.5-year program (plus internship) for students who already hold an undergraduate or graduate degree:
  • Phase 1: Foundations (Year 1): Intensive core medical sciences (Anatomy, Physiology, Pathology) combined with computational skills (Python, R, Statistics).
  • Phase 2: Research & PhD (Years 2-5): Full immersion in one of Weizmann’s 250+ labs. Students maintain clinical relevance through weekly "Medical Research Education" sessions.
  • Phase 3: Clinical Clerkships (Years 6-7.5): 77 weeks of intense clinical rotations in major Israeli hospitals.
  • Instruction: Primarily Hebrew (clinical) and English (research). Students are expected to be fluent in both, as research at Weizmann is conducted entirely in English while patient care is in Hebrew.
  • Research Focus: Unparalleled access to all scientific disciplines including Physics, Chemistry, Math, and Computer Science not just Biology.
  • Admission: Extremely selective. Admits up to 40 students annually (the inaugural 2025 class was smaller due to regional constraints). Candidates are evaluated on academic excellence, research potential, and clinical empathy through a multi-stage interview process.

Hospital & Medical Facilities

Leading tertiary care hospital attached to the institution

The program features a unique decentralized clinical model, partnering with the "Big Four" of Israeli healthcare:

  • Sheba Medical Center (Tel Hashomer): The primary partner in designing the curriculum and a top-10 global hospital.
  • Tel Aviv Sourasky Medical Center (Ichilov): Provides intensive rotations in urban trauma and specialized medicine.
  • Rambam Health Care Campus (Haifa): Offers experience in advanced surgical and technological medical applications.
  • Assuta Medical Center (Ashdod): A modern facility focusing on personalized and community-integrated medicine.
  • Clalit Health Services: Provides clinical training within Israel’s largest public health provider network.

Miscellaneous

  • Degree Awarded: Dual Doctorate (MD and PhD).
  • Leadership: Led by Prof. Ayelet Erez and Prof. Liran Shlush, both world-class Weizmann PIs and practicing physicians.
  • Goal: To create a cadre of professionals who can "speak both languages" clinical medicine and basic science to lead the next revolution in personalized medicine.
